Interpreting the Dream of Seeing Peppers

Dreams have long fascinated humanity, serving as a gateway into the subconscious mind. Among the myriad of symbols that appear in our dreams, food is a common motif that often carries rich meanings. One such food is the pepper, a vibrant and multifaceted vegetable that can hold significant emotional and psychological symbolism when it appears in our dreams. In this blog post, we will delve into the various interpretations of dreaming about peppers, examining the deeper meanings and associations that this dream might evoke.

Seeing peppers in a dream can symbolize a range of emotions, from passion and excitement to anger and frustration. The color of the peppers may also contribute to their interpretation. For example, red peppers often symbolize passion, desire, and intensity, while green peppers can represent freshness and renewal. The psychological implications of these colors can offer us insights into what our subconscious might be trying to communicate through the imagery of peppers.

From a psychological perspective, peppers can also represent your desires and appetites, both physical and emotional. Just as peppers can add flavor and zest to a dish, your subconscious might be signaling a desire for more excitement or stimulation in your waking life. This dream could be urging you to explore your passions more deeply or embrace new experiences that enrich your life.

Moreover, dreaming of peppers can also indicate a need for self-expression. In many cultures, food is often linked to community, family, and sharing. Seeing peppers in your dream might suggest that you are craving connection with others, or perhaps it signifies that you have something important to share with those around you. This dream could be prompting you to communicate your thoughts, feelings, or creative ideas more openly, encouraging you to spice up your relationships and interactions.

On the flip side, peppers can also symbolize irritability or conflict. If the peppers in your dream are associated with heat, spice, or discomfort, it might indicate underlying tensions or frustrations in your life. This could be reflective of a situation or relationship that is causing you distress. The heat of the peppers might symbolize the anger or irritation you are experiencing, suggesting that there is something unresolved that needs your attention.

In some cases, the act of preparing or cooking with peppers in your dream can reveal even more layers of meaning. Cooking often symbolizes transformation and the process of making something new out of raw ingredients. This could indicate that you are in a phase of personal growth, where you are working through your feelings or situations to create a better outcome. The presence of peppers in this context may suggest that you are incorporating vitality and zest into your transformation process, encouraging you to embrace the changes you are undergoing.

Furthermore, the location where you see the peppers can also have significance. For instance, if you dream about peppers in a grocery store, it might imply that you are in a phase of exploration and discovery, seeking new opportunities or experiences to enhance your life. Conversely, if the peppers appear in a chaotic or cluttered environment, it could reflect feelings of overwhelm or confusion, suggesting that you may need to declutter your thoughts and emotions.

When interpreting any dream, it is essential to consider the personal context of the dreamer. For instance, if you have a fond memory associated with peppers—perhaps they remind you of a favorite dish from your childhood—then the dream might be tapping into those nostalgic feelings. Alternatively, if you dislike peppers or have had negative experiences related to them, the dream may carry a different, potentially more adverse meaning.
